Career Guidance and Placement Centre
Nizam College
Annual Report
Unlike general atmosphere of uncertainty due to global economic slowdown, in fiscal year 2012-13, the recruiters have continued to show positive interest in our students.
Campus placement from September 2012 saw participation of around five major globally renowned companies, IBM, Genpact, Satyam Mahindra, ADP. These companies carry the reputation of being very selective in their choice of campuses and of having extremely high standers in their recruitment process.
The process began in September with invitation to companies visit the institute for pre-placement tlak and provides their job announcements. On average 70 candidates appeared for each of the companies and total 30 candidates were recruitment this year.
We had also internship and training program by Sony Pvt. Ltd. And Walmart in collaboration with Bharti Centum learning limited for all graduates. Corpy edge ( staffing and training )operations in US, UK and India firm had placement drive in 42 colleges around city for MBA final year out which 2 candidates were selected.
We also conducted AMCAT (Aspiring minds computer aptitude test) Exam, where 100 students appeared for Exam. The purpose of the test is to gauge employability for various industrial sector and job profiles.
Seminars were also conducted on topics like career and education:
Scientology
International Students exchange program
Career Scope after graduation
Seeing a study growth in the recruitment in these companies Placement and Training Department started communication classes for graduates. There is good number of participation from students.
Placement office through campus placement has made a notional contribution to the institute.
